云服务器什么配置能满足mysql服务正常运行?

优化选择:云服务器配置对MySQL服务的支撑策略

结论:

在当今数字化时代,数据库管理系统如MySQL在各种业务场景中扮演着至关重要的角色。选择合适的云服务器配置以确保MySQL服务的稳定运行,是保障业务流程顺畅的关键。理想的云服务器配置应具备足够的计算能力、内存容量、存储空间和网络带宽,同时也要考虑到安全性和可扩展性。具体而言,至少需要2核CPU、4GB内存、500GB硬盘和稳定的网络环境,但实际需求可能会根据业务规模和流量进行调整。

分析探讨:

  1. CPU与计算能力:MySQL服务对CPU的需求主要体现在数据查询和处理上。对于小型应用,2核CPU基本可以满足需求。然而,由于业务量的增长,可能需要更高的核心数来处理并发请求。例如,大型电商网站在促销期间可能会面临大量并发查询,此时4核或以上的CPU配置更为合适。

  2. 内存:内存是影响MySQL性能的关键因素,因为它直接影响数据缓存的大小。一般推荐至少4GB内存,对于需要处理大量复杂查询或者高并发场景的应用,8GB或更高内存是必要的,以确保数据能快速读取和写入。

  3. 存储:硬盘类型和大小也是关键考虑因素。MySQL通常需要大量的磁盘空间来存储数据,至少500GB的硬盘空间是基础配置。此外,SSD硬盘由于其高速读写性能,相比HDD更适合MySQL这样的高性能数据库系统。

  4. 网络带宽:云服务器的网络带宽决定了数据传输的速度。如果应用涉及大量数据交换,如实时数据分析或大数据处理,那么高带宽是必需的。对于大多数中小型企业,100Mbps的带宽已经足够,但对于大型企业,可能需要提升到1Gbps或更高。

  5. 安全与扩展性:云服务器的安全性同样重要,包括数据加密、防火墙设置等。此外,考虑到业务的未来发展,选择支持无缝升级的云服务商,可以避免未来因硬件限制而进行的复杂迁移。

总结来说,云服务器配置的选择并非一成不变,而是需要根据实际业务需求进行动态调整。在预算允许的情况下,适度的超前配置可以为未来的业务增长提供更好的支持。同时,定期评估和优化MySQL服务的性能,也能帮助我们更有效地利用云服务器资源,实现服务的高效稳定运行。

未经允许不得转载:CCLOUD博客 » 云服务器什么配置能满足mysql服务正常运行?